The cost of the project is calculated according to the number of trips to excavate from a tank. Generally we motivate the villagers to take minimum of 4000 tractor loads of silt to have significant impact. If the villagers are active in large number, good silt available in the tank then the loads will be increased accordingly without limitation.
Bala Vikasa pays Rs. 30 for loading each tractor and on an average each farmers will spend about Rs. 60 for transport and Rs. 10 for spreading the silt in the farm which makes a total or Rs. 70 by farmers. The ratio is 30 : 70%
To excavate 4000 loads * Rs. 30 = Rs. 1,20,000 ( 2,700 US $)
To transport and spread 4000 lads * Rs. 70 ( 60+10) = Rs. 2,80,000 ( 6,370 US $)
